WebFeb 8, 2024 · 2 Days Before Your Procedure Stop taking n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) Stop taking NSAIDs, such as ibuprofen (Advil ® and Motrin ®) and naproxen (Aleve ®), 2 days before your procedure. NSAIDs can cause bleeding. If your healthcare provider gives you other instructions, follow those instead.

After the procedure, a flexible tube (catheter) may be inserted into the bladder through the urethra to assist with draining urine from the bladder. The catheter will usually stay in place for 1 to 3 days. For a few days after the catheter is removed, the patient may have difficulty controlling their urine. Your healthcare provider may recommend you stop taking any medications that risk bleeding during your bladder surgery. You should stop the following medications about a week before: NSAIDs, including: Ibuprofen (Advil®). Naproxen (Aleve®). Blood thinners, such as: Warfarin (Coumadin®).
